Cole, Lorne D. - 87, Truro Heights passed away peacefully June 15, 2009 in Colchester Regional Hospital, Truro. Born in Richmond, Cumberland County on November 29, 1921, he was a son of the late Dimock and Kate (MacNeil) Cole. Lorne started working in the woods in his early teens before he worked in the trucking business. He purchased a small business and built it into Cole’s Transfer Limited, a major employer in Tatamagouche during the 1960’s, later relocating to North River. His business expanded over mainland Nova Scotia and New Brunswick where he operated it until it was sold to Speedway Transport in the early seventies. Lorne was a member of Sharon United Church, Tatamagouche and served as a volunteer member of the Tatamagouche Fire Department and a founding member of the North River Fire Brigade. He was a Nova Scotia Hunting Guide for over 50 years developing lifelong friendships with his American friends.
